"Just a little bit more, and I'll be able to start cultivation."
An over-enthusiastic boy could be seen talking to himself. The boy was standing on a cliff with his ink-black hair fluttering in the air, if one were to look from a distance, it would seem a monarch overlooking their territory. Ever since he could perceive his surroundings, he was amazed by the older people's abilities.
They could condense what was known as qi and do amazing feats like flying. This greatly impressed the little Lin Feng since he had discovered painfully he couldn't fly. He had asked his mother how he too could also do the same, but he was told he needed to start cultivation, and to his disappointment, he needed to be twelve years old to embark on the journey. His mother explained to him that it was something related to his fleshy body not being able to handle qi circulation. At least, that is what he understood from the explanation he was given. Lin Feng waited for four long years, but finally, the time arrived as expected. Though the four years had been long, his father, the patriarch of the Lin family, had subjected him to excruciating exercises.
'well, I guess I should head back home."
Lin Feng muttered to himself as he walked back to his house with his hands behind his back, imitating the old ancestors of the family. As he approached his house, he saw a boy roughly his age pacing back and forth in front of his courtyard. Lin Feng couldn't help but furrow his brows because he didn't expect someone to visit him unless his father summoned him.
Sure enough, when the boy saw him, he immediately cupped his fist and handed him a letter before bolting off as if he had encountered his natural enemy. Lin Feng couldn't help but smile wryly. His father threatened to exile anyone who associated with him with the excuse of wanting him to learn to be independent. Lin Feng didn't care much about it as he had already learned to be self-sufficient.

He read the letter from his father as he walked to his house. From the letter, his father told him to go to the main hall to open his meridians. He threw the letter on the table as he took the already cold meal prepared in the morning before going to his exercise routine.
He ate the uninteresting food bitterly. Anyways he had heard that at a certain stage in cultivation, cultivators didn't need to eat, so he had never taken preparing meals seriously. He then jumped on his bed as he recalled his successful training exercises. He remembered how his father had strictly supervised him until he got used to the training.
Speaking of his father, Lin Yao, all he knows about him was that he is a powerful cultivator that his grandfather brought from somewhere and introduced him as his son to the shock of the elders.
Some elders were against it, but they disappeared mysteriously, and the rest could only accept reluctantly. His father then proceeded to "convince" the other families to become the subsidiary families of their Lin family hence becoming the most powerful family in the northern kingdom, apart from the royal family.
This had made many younger generations worship his father and treat his words as law. His father had then gone on to marry from the second most powerful family, the Zhao family. After merging the two families, Lin Feng was born. His early childhood was normal until he showed interest in cultivation. His father had then appeared and started training his body. His mother, on the other hand, stopped seeing him. He had been sad for quite some time before adapting to it and developing the self-dependence they wanted him to have. Lin Feng put the thoughts at the back of his mind, and he couldn't help but smile when he thought about cultivation.

"what do you think about the boy?" An old voice could be heard from a hidden room in the main hall of the Lin family.
"The outcome will be the same whether he has a high or low talent. All we need is time." A cold, indifferent voice could be heard replying to the old man beside him. These two were the father and grandfather pair of Lin Feng.
Their planning and brutal actions had devastated families in the northern kingdom. It was a pair that many families and small sects dreaded.
"Do you need to do that to your son? Can't you pick anyone from the branch families? They are more useless than my son." A Beautiful voice interrupted the two. This voice belonged to Zhao Lin, Lin Feng's mother.
"You do know this is for both our families to be able to overcome those royal dogs."
Lin Yao answered her coldly, thinking how long he has been stuck at the peak of Domain formation. His chance to advance to the void transformation realm finally had come. He couldn't allow this to be hindered because of stupid emotions like family love.
Zhao Lin hesitated for a while before nodding, she had never been a good mother, but that didn't mean she liked the idea for her son to be treated as a cultivation tool. She was a possessive woman, so she didn't like her things being taken away from her. This thought only flashed briefly through her mind before she discarded it. Anyway, she was getting a better deal out of it. After her husband takes over the kingdom, she would naturally become the queen. Thinking of this, she couldn't help but be expectant of the future.
As others were dictating his future, Lin Feng had no way of knowing he was already a fish on a chopping board. He had the most comfortable sleep he had ever had for a long time as he dreamt of the journey he was to start on the following day.
